I-605 between I-10 and I-210
CHP heavily enforces speed limits in both directions of the 605 in this area. It’s pretty wide open, and traffic usually light, so it’s easy to get nabbed. Ka band radar, but lately some units seem to be laser gun equipped.

North bound on Azusa Canyon Rd, just before Arrow Highway
The Speed limit is 40 MPH, however it is used as an alternate route by many commuters. There is often a motorcyle cop hiding behind a white wall next to the Verizon building with his radar gun.
Cypress Street between N. Vincent/Irwindale Ave
Right at Merwin Elementary school at the Covina/Irwindale border the speed changes in the middle of the road…if you are headed west on Cypress you go from a 40 to a 35 MPH zone, east bound you go from a 35 to a 40 MPH zone. Irwindale PD is watching you
